About the role
Responsibilities
- Perform repetitive line operations to assemble axles for Ford Bronco and Ranger products
- Maintain high quality standards and check finished products for faults or inconsistencies
- Follow all safety guidelines and advocate for safe practices among production staff
- Report machine, equipment, or safety malfunctions to the supervisor or team leader immediately
- Train and operate various workstations across the assembly line
- Participate in continuous improvement initiatives following the Dana Operating System (DOS)

About the Company
Dana is a global leader in the supply of highly engineered driveline, sealing, and thermal-management technologies. We serve the passenger vehicle, commercial truck, and off-highway equipment markets, providing essential components to the world's leading original-equipment manufacturers.
